fork(1) download
  1. #include <stdio.h>
  2. void conta(int matriz[5][3], int * vet)
  3. {
  4. for (int i = 0 ; i<5; i++)
  5. {
  6. for (int j = 0; j<3;j++)
  7. {
  8. matriz [i][j] = i+j;
  9.  
  10. vet[i] += matriz[i][j];
  11. }
  12. }
  13. }
  14.  
  15. void imprimir(int matriz[5][3], int * vet)
  16. {
  17. for (int i = 0 ; i<5; i++)
  18. {
  19. for (int j = 0; j<3;j++)
  20. {
  21. printf("%d",matriz [i][j]);
  22. }
  23. printf("\n");
  24. }
  25.  
  26. for (int i = 0; i < 5; ++i)
  27. {
  28. printf("soma linha %d : %d \n", i , vet[i] );
  29. }
  30. }
  31. int main()
  32. {
  33. int matriz [5][3];
  34. int vet[5] = {0};
  35.  
  36. conta(matriz,vet);
  37. imprimir(matriz,vet);
  38. return 0;
  39. }
  40.  
Success #stdin #stdout 0s 9424KB
stdin
Standard input is empty
stdout
012
123
234
345
456
soma linha 0 : 3 
soma linha 1 : 6 
soma linha 2 : 9 
soma linha 3 : 12 
soma linha 4 : 15